Promotional campaign runs until 8/31 for new TIDAL users only.
Single Plan: After the promotional period, you continue to listen for $9.99 / month for a HiFi subscription or $19.99 / month for a HiFi Plus subscription.
Family Plan: After the promotional period, you continue to listen for $14.99 / month for a HiFi subscription or $29.99 / month for a HiFi Plus subscription.

This or through best buy subscription for .01? I hear canceling through best buy can be troublesome
I've bought and canceled the Best Buy subscription more times than I can count. It's never been a problem, you just need to understand that because it's "managed by Best Buy" you can only cancel on their site, not tidal.com.
By the way I always seem to get a few weeks extra even after the 3 months are up. Once my subscription has truly lapsed, I just buy another.
BTW do not buy a bunch to use in the future, the clock starts ticking with the date of purchase, not when you activate.
